BALTIMORE (AP) — Engineers in Maryland are focused on the daunting task of removing what had been the Francis Scott Key Bridge from the Patapsco River. A massive cargo ship felled the span Tuesday after striking one of its main supports. Salvage crews will want to break the broken bridge parts into even smaller pieces to lift them out of the water. The tools needed for that are coming into place. They include seven floating cranes, 10 tugboats and nine barges. Clearing the river will allow officials to reopen the economically vital Port of Baltimore.
